Service on Mercedes diesel turbo 5

jdh, 09/18/2010
2007 Dodge Sprinter 2500 170 WB 3dr Ext Van (3.0L 6cyl Turbodiesel 5A)
19 of 19 people found this review helpful

Terrible availability of service. Not all Dodge dealers work on Sprinters. Mercedes won't touch them. Had no service for blown resonator on turbo in N. CA. Towed Yreka 100 mi to Redding. No service Mercedes or Dodge. Drove 200+ mi to Sacramento @ 45mph. Few dealers work on this engine. Everyone passes buck on engine. Unless Dodge or Mercedes picks up responsibility on engine would not buy again. Have RV. 16 mpg. Nice, but if you are stuck in Palucaville and need service you are out of luck. Freight-liner wouldn't work on RV either since Dodge will not give them any warranty work.

DO NOT BUY!!!

jjaskot, 07/12/2012
2007 Dodge Sprinter 2500 144 WB 3dr Van (3.0L 6cyl Turbodiesel 5A)
22 of 23 people found this review helpful

I run a fleet of 6 sprinters. I have 2- 2004 models and had relative success with them. We service high end appliances and the exterior design and styling definitely appealed to us. We then bought 4 2007 model and have regretted that decision ever since. We have made repair after repair on all of the new vans. It honestly seems like the improvements involved just TOO MUCH technology. TOO Many Sensors and TOO many complicated electronics. Our maintenance bills on these 5 vans have gotten to the point where we just want to unload all of them. I wouldnt recommend the newer generations Sprinters to my worst enemy.

The real scoop on a Sprinter passenger van

Patrick Thiel, 01/14/2019
updated 02/10/2023
2007 Dodge Sprinter 2500 144 WB 3dr Van (3.0L 6cyl Turbodiesel 5A)
14 of 15 people found this review helpful

The van is a 144 passenger low roof 2500 3.0 diesel. These Van's are superior to anything built in terms of quality, safety, reliability, longevity and functionality. They lack for traction in snow or mud unless you go 4wd or have a load. The engines and transmissions are long lived. 500,000 to 600,000 miles is reasonable to expect from this quality of a Mercedes product. Buying used in the 140,000 mile range is the best dollar per mile value. There is a real advantage to units with the Assyst diagnostic package, so buy a unit with the steering wheel controls if you can! My oil change intervals with 70% highway miles have been 15,000 (Mobil 1 always). My 07 is at 442,000 miles and and has been through a starter and power steering pump, alternator, recent in tank fuel pump, glow plug controller, replaced the transmission conductor plate myself and the full drive shaft. Torque converter is still original but grabs 2nd hard on light deceleration at times. I trick it out of limp mode with an MD 808 in DPF regen mode. . The engine is as good as when it was new with oil consumption 1 qt per 15k (same as new). My 04 had 240,000 upon trade in and my 08 has 342,000- all 3 solid with only starter, alternator or water pump replacements. My average fuel economy is 20-21mpg (23 on the '04) with ton and a half+ loads. Dealers charge double for parts so do the work yourself using good quality parts and spare no cost to use the proper fluids. Check forums for information. Use a dealer to do transmission services at between 50k to 100k. I have not personally known a transmission to go bad in these units. The transmission filters are so good they will start to plug up and seem that there is transmission trouble. Just service the trans and tell any pessimistic mechanic you will see them for the next service, and the next... Visibility is the best. Acceleration will surprise you. The engines are turned down at the factory and they still perform well unchipped. I have hours of ideling per trip to keep produce warm in winter without much affect adversely on the motor over these many miles. The 350000 mile range is when you pour money into these, but they are worth the cost of repair if you are doing the work yourself.

A Perfect Van for Handicapped Use

Bobby Baker, 07/27/2007
2007 Dodge Sprinter 2500 144 WB 3dr Van (3.0L 6cyl Turbodiesel 5A)
4 of 4 people found this review helpful

Peripheral vision is excellent. Seats 10. Fuel mileage unbelievable 28mpg. Sufficient low end torque. Drives exceptionally well on highway for what it is. We installed rear lift for handicapped sister and removed the 2 seat row and moved the rear set of 3 seats up. Can transport sister and 8 additional passengers. Side door first step is a little high for elderly and children, but overall an excellent vehicle. We researched all possible vans prior to purchase. This was the only reasonable option. I am 6'1" and can stand up straight inside. We had extreme difficulty finding a diesel with rear a/c. We drove 400 miles to Myrtle Beach to pick this van up. We are completely satisfied.
